@charset "utf-8";

body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,fieldset,legend,button,input,textarea,table,th,td,section,article,aside,header,footer,nav,dialog,figure{margin:0;padding:0;}
body,button,input,select,textarea{font:14px/1.5 verdana,\5FAE\8F6F\96C5\9ED1,sans-serif;}
section,article,aside,header,footer,nav,dialog,figure{display:block;}
fieldset,img{border:0;}

address,caption,cite,code,dfn,em,b,th,var,i{font-weight:normal; font-style:normal;}
code,kbd,pre,samp{font-family:courier new,courier,monospace;}
ol,ul{list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
q:before,q:after{content:"";}
abbr,acronym{border:0;}
select,input,button,buttonimg,textarea,label,img{margin:0;vertical-align:middle;}

b{font-weight:bold;}
.clear{ overflow:hidden; clear:both;}
.clearfix:after{clear:both; overflow:hidden;content:".";}
/*-----common------*/
a{text-decoration:none;color:#353535; cursor:pointer}
a:hover{text-decoration:none;color:inherit;}
.undis{ display:none}
.left {float:left}
.right {float:right}
/*----layout----*/

.wrap{width:1000px; margin:0px auto; z-index:1;}
.hr30{height:30px; clear:both; overflow:hidden}
.hr40{height:40px; clear:both; overflow:hidden}
.f-st{font-family:\5b8b\4f53}
.font14{font-size:14px}
.font15{font-size:15px}
.font16{font-size:16px}
.font18{font-size:18px}
.font24{font-size:24px}
.details{color:#4ea7df;padding-left:8px}
.mt45{margin-top:45px}
.detail{
	color:#F21F1F;
	margin-left:2px;
	cursor:pointer;}
input{
	padding:2px 5px 2px;
	border:none;}
textarea{
	padding:5px;
	border:none;}
button{
	border:none;}
.songti{
	font-family:\5b8b\4f53;
	color:#242424;}
.content{
	width:1000px;
	margin:0 auto;
	position:relative;}
.amore{
	width:50px;
	height:20px;
	position:absolute;
	right:5px;}
.header{
	height:514px;
	background:url(header.jpg) no-repeat center top;}
.mid{
	background-color:#FBF0DC;
	padding-top: 20px;}
#baodao{
	overflow:auto;
	height:320px;
	}
#baodao .left{
	width:500px;
	height:320px;}
#slides2 {
	position:relative;}
#slides2 .slidesjs-navigation{
	position:absolute;
	top:160px;
	z-index:100;}
#slides2 .slidesjs-next{
	right:0px;}
#slides2 .slidesjs-slide p{
	position:absolute;
	bottom:0px;
	width: 100%;
    line-height: 35px;
	background: rgba(0,0,0,0.6);
filter: progid:DXImageTransform.Microsoft.gradient( GradientType = 0,startColorstr = '#80000000',endColorstr = '#80000000')\9;
}
#slides2 .slidesjs-slide p a{
	color:#FFF;
	margin-left:25px;}
#slides2 .slidesjs-pagination{
	position:absolute;
	right:25px;
	bottom:0px;
	z-index:100;
	line-height:35px;}
#slides2 .slidesjs-slide img{
	width:500px;
	height:320px;
	}
#slides2 .slidesjs-pagination-item{
	float:left;


	width:10px;
	height:35px;
	margin-left:5px;}
#slides2 .slidesjs-pagination-item a{
	width:10px;
	height:35px;
	background:url(slhui.png) no-repeat center;
	text-indent:-9999px;
	display:block;
	}
#slides2 .slidesjs-pagination-item a.active{
	background:url(slhong.png) no-repeat center;
	}
#baodao .right{
	width:480px;

	float:right;
	position:relative;
	font-size:14px;}
#baodao .right.amore{right:5px;}
#baodao .right img{
	float:right;}
#baodao .right p{
	text-indent:2em;
	color:#2e2e2e;
	}
#baodao .right div{
	clear:both;
	padding:13px 0;
	}
#baodao .right div+div{
	border-top:1px dotted #999999;
	}
#baodao .right h2{
	text-align:center;
	font-size:18px;

	}
#baodao .right h2 a{
	color:#000;
	}
#baodao .right span{
	font-size:18px;
	float:left;
	font-weight:bold;
	color:#2A2A2A;
	line-height:27px;
	margin:10px 0;}
#baodao .right  .detail{

	font-size:14px;
	font-weight:normal;}
.huodong {
	width:100%;
	text-align:center;
	padding:30px 0;
	position:relative;}

.huodong  .amore{right: 250px;
top: 70px;}
.huodong .jingcai{
	padding:10px 0;
	text-align:left;
	height:116px;
	}
.huodong div+div{
	border-top:1px dotted #A4211F}

.huodong  .jingcai img{
	float:left;
	margin-right:20px;
	width:180px;
	height:115px;}
.huodong  .jingcai h2{margin-bottom:15px;}
.huodong  .jingcai h2 a{
	color:#E32E2E;
	font-size:18px;}

.huodong  .jingcai p{
	text-indent:2em;
	height:60px;
	overflow:hidden;
	line-height:30px;}
.huodong  .jingcai p a{
	color:#E32E2E;
	}
.mid1{
	background:url(denglong.jpg) no-repeat center top;
	height:1476px;
	}
.mid1 .content{
	position:relative;
	overflow:auto;
	height:1476px;}
.mid1 .que{
	width:300px;
	position:absolute;
	}
.mid1 .que .denglong{
	position:relative;
	width:203px;
	height:225px;
	background:url(denglong.png) no-repeat;
	padding-top:80px;
	float:left;}
.mid1 .que .daan{
	float:right;
	width:97px;
	margin-top:70px;}
.mid1 .que .timu{
	width:150px;
	text-align:center;
	margin:0 auto;}
.mid1 .daan input{
	display:none;}
.mid1 .daan	label{
	width:97px;
	height:auto;}
.mid1 .daan span{width: 12px;
height: 12px;
display: inline-block;
background: url(weigou.jpg) no-repeat;
vertical-align: middle;
cursor: pointer;
margin-right: 10px;}
.mid1 .daan input:checked + label span {
background:url(gou.png)  no-repeat;
}
.mid1 .que1{
	top:337px;
	left:45px;}
.mid1 .que2{top: 348px;
left: 350px;}
.mid1 .que2 .denglong{
	padding-top:65px;
	height:270px;
	}
.mid1 .que3{
	top:330px;
	right:50px;}
.mid1 .que4{
	top:678px;
	left:45px;}
.mid1 .que5{
	top:690px;
	left:350px;}
.mid1 .que6{
	top:671px;
	right:50px;}
.mid1 .que7{
	top:1021px;
	left:45px;}
.mid1 .que8{
	top:1032px;
	left:350px;}
.mid1 .que9{
	top:1013px;
	right:50px;}
.mid1 form{
	position:absolute;
	bottom:80px;
	width:100%;}
.error{
	color:#F00;}
.mid2 .error{
	color:#FFF;}
.mid1 form p{
	text-align:center;}
.mid2{
	background:url(liuyanbg.jpg) top center no-repeat;
	height:904px;}
.mid2 .liuyanban{
	background:url(liuyanban.jpg) top center no-repeat;
	height:387px;}
.mid2 .form2{
	padding-top:140px;
	width:800px;
	margin:0 auto;}
.mid2 .form2 p{
	margin-bottom:15px;}
.mid2 .form2 span{
	width:100px;
	margin-right:20px;
	display:inline-block;
	color:#FFF;
	text-align:right;}
.mid2 .form2 input{
	width:200px;}
.mid2 .form2 textarea{
	width:400px;
	height:100px;}
.mid2 .form2 button{
	cursor:pointer;}
.mid2 .liuyan{
	width:945px;
	margin:0 auto;}
.mid2 .liuyan div{
	float:left;
	background:url(liuyan.jpg) center top no-repeat;
	width:315px;
	height:211px;
	margin-bottom:20px;}
.mid2 .liuyan div h2{
	width:160px;
	text-align:center;
	margin:0 auto;
	color:#FFE7A8;
	font-size:16px;
	margin-top:15px;}
.mid2 .liuyan div p{
	width: 200px;
margin: 0 auto;
line-height: 25px;
margin-top: 35px;
height: 75px;
overflow: hidden;
color:#E24E2C}
.footer{
	clear:both;
	background:url(footer.jpg) no-repeat;
	text-align:center;
	color:#fff;
	padding:35px 0 30px;
	height:100px;}
.footer p+p{
	margin-top:10px;}


 @-webkit-keyframes gundong{
            0%{
                -webkit-transform:rotate(2deg);
				-moz-transform:rotate(2deg);
				-ms-transform:rotate(2deg);
				transform:rotate(2deg);
            }

            100%{
                -webkit-transform:rotate(-2deg);
				-moz-transform:rotate(-2deg);
				-ms-transform:rotate(-2deg);
				transform:rotate(-2deg);
            }

        }
 @-ms-keyframes gundong{
            0%{
                -webkit-transform:rotate(2deg);
				-moz-transform:rotate(2deg);
				-ms-transform:rotate(2deg);
				transform:rotate(2deg);
            }

            100%{
                -webkit-transform:rotate(-2deg);
				-moz-transform:rotate(-2deg);
				-ms-transform:rotate(-2deg);
				transform:rotate(-2deg);
            }

        }
@-moz-keyframes gundong{
            0%{
                -webkit-transform:rotate(2deg);
				-moz-transform:rotate(2deg);
				-ms-transform:rotate(2deg);
				transform:rotate(2deg);
            }

            100%{
                -webkit-transform:rotate(-2deg);
				-moz-transform:rotate(-2deg);
				transform:rotate(-2deg);
				-ms-transform:rotate(-2deg);
            }

        }
.denglong {
			z-index:100;

            -webkit-animation-name:gundong;
            -webkit-animation-duration:3s;
            -webkit-animation-direction:alternate;
            -webkit-animation-iteration-count:infinite;
            -webkit-animation-timing-function:ease-in;

			 -moz-animation-name:gundong;
            -moz-animation-duration:3s;
            -moz-animation-direction:alternate;
            -moz-animation-iteration-count:infinite;
            -moz-animation-timing-function:ease-in;


			 -ms-animation-name:gundong;
            -ms-animation-duration:3s;
            -ms-animation-direction:alternate;
            -ms-animation-iteration-count:infinite;
            -ms-animation-timing-function:ease-in;

			animation-name:gundong;
            animation-duration:3s;
            animation-direction:alternate;
            animation-iteration-count:infinite;
            animation-timing-function:ease-in;
        }
